    The augmented-fourth interval is the only interval whose inverse is the same as itself. The augmented-fourths tuning is the only tuning (other than the 'trivial' tuning C-C-C-C-C-C) for which all chords-forms remain unchanged when the strings are reversed. Thus the augmented-fourths tuning is its own 'lefty' tuning." [2]

    It is a tritone because F–G, G–A, and A–B are three adjacent whole tones. It is a fourth because the notes from F to B are four (F, G, A, B). It is augmented (i.e., widened) because it is wider than most of the fourths found in the scale (they are perfect fourths). According to this interpretation, the d5 is not a tritone.

    Augmented-fourths tuning, for example, B-F-b-f-b'-f'. Any note fingered on one string can be fingered on two other strings. Thus chords can be fingered in many ways in augmented-fourths tuning. It is also a regular tuning in which the interval between its strings is a tritone (augmented fourth). [4] A cittern tuning, such as C-G-c-g-c'-g'. [5]
